Abstract

A diode phase-shifting device for an electronically scanning antenna includes a cut-off device designed to operate when the phase-shifting diodes are switched to their non-conducting state, with a view to increasing the switchover speed. This device comprises mainly a low-voltage generator, a circuit breaker or switch, and a high-voltage generator. A switching from the low-voltage generator to the high-voltage generator occurs when the voltage at the terminals of the phase-shifting diode considered exceeds a given threshold value.
